Yen Ching
Came in not knowing what to order, asked for a recommendation that was spicy but also savory. They recommended the teriyaki chicken. It was delicious, also a very big portion (picture is about 1/3 of the total food) Extremely good customer service throughout my dining experience. Really fast service as well
This is my favorite chinse restaurant. The food is great, and the servers are very attentive. It seems a bit pricey, but the flavors are worth it. I always have the Seafood Sizzling Bowl. The rice is prepared in toasted, crisp waffer like chunks that compliments the shrimp, pee pods, and slivers of beef. It is in a busy location across from the Galleria Shopping Mall. There is off street parking available just south of the restaurant. If you exit behind the buildings, there is a stoplight for an easy left turn on Brentwood Avenue.
